
About this episode
In the story of Dexter Doodle and the Remote of Reality, a young boy discovers a magical device capable of manipulating time and physical laws. While Dexter initially enjoys the power to pause and alter his surroundings, he quickly finds that skipping through time leads to chaotic consequences and missed opportunities. His journey through alternate dimensions and accidental time travel teaches him that trying to bypass life's challenges often results in losing the meaningful moments of the present. Ultimately, the narrative serves as a whimsical lesson for children about the value of experiencing life as it happens. By returning his world to its original state, Dexter realizes that even the mundane aspects of daily life are worth living in real-time.
